Earlier this month the New York Times wrote “Some of [John Cornhole] Cornyn’s donors have had serious concerns in recent months about his viability, according to people close to them, but they now largely think he will at least make the runoff. What happens next is a subject of debate. Some donors are hoping to save resources for the May runoff. But some major donors feel ‘fatalistic’ about the embattled Mr Cornyn, in the words of one adviser, and some are already privately wondering when, not whether, wealthy Republicans should cut bait, according to two people close to those donors. Some establishment Republicans worry that no matter his financial advantage, he will be a serious underdog against Mr Paxton in the runoff – and that donors’ money would be better spent helping Republicans like Senator Susan Collins of Maine in the fall,” and just let that hang there.
